This study aims to describe the local wisdom presented in the novel La Muli by Nunuk Y. Kusmiana and to explore its implications for reinforcing independent character education.This study uses a descriptive qualitative method with literature study and content analysis. This research is based on the approach of literary sociology. The research data consisted of phrases, sentences, and words in the novel La Muli related to local wisdom. The data sources are in the form of the novel La Muli, by Nunuk Y. Kusmiana, scientific journal articles, and learning tools. Data collection through literature study techniques, record techniques, and document analysis. Sampling was carried out by purposive sampling. The validity of the data is checked through triangulation of data sources and techniques. The data was analyzed using content analysis. The results of the study show that the novel La Muli represents various forms of local wisdom of the Buton people through three categories, namely 1) human-human relations (social relations) shown through respect for parents and social responsibility, 2) human relations with nature and time (ecological relations) are shown from harmony with nature fostering time discipline, sense of responsibility, and resilient attitudes, 3) Human relationships with themselves (spiritual relationships) and 4) Man's relationship with God (theological relationship) are represented through the values of honesty and self-integrity. These values are reflected in the behavior of the main character, La Muli, who is described as an independent, responsible, and integrity person in the midst of the limitations, social and economic challenges he faces. The picture provides important lessons about courage, resilience, and independence. The representation of local wisdom in this novel has strong implications for strengthening independent character education. Local values instilled through stories help students form characters who are courageous, disciplined, and independent of others, in line with the principles of character education. For this reason, the implications of this finding can be used as a basis for the development of literary learning and character education, by integrating local wisdom as a reinforcement of independent character education in the younger generation.
